What is Canva Training?

Canva training encompasses a range of resources and programs designed to empower users of all skill levels to elevate their design skills. These programs can take various forms, including:

  • Online Courses: Comprehensive courses covering various aspects of Canva, from basic design principles to advanced techniques.
  • Tutorials and Videos: Bite-sized lessons that focus on specific Canva features, tools, and design styles.
  • Workshops and Webinars: Interactive sessions led by experts that provide practical guidance and hands-on practice.
  • Certification Programs: Formal programs that validate your Canva proficiency and demonstrate your expertise.

Types of Canva Training

Canva training programs cater to different needs and skill levels. Here are some common types of training you might encounter:

  • Beginner-Level Training: Introduces the basics of Canva, covering essential tools, design principles, and creating simple designs.
  • Intermediate-Level Training: Delves deeper into Canva’s features, exploring advanced design techniques, branding strategies, and creating more complex designs.
  • Advanced-Level Training: Focuses on specialized areas, such as animation, video editing, and using Canva for specific industries or purposes.
  • Industry-Specific Training: Tailored to meet the unique needs of specific industries, offering insights into best practices and design trends.

3. What are the best Canva training resources?

Several excellent Canva training resources are available, including Canva’s own website, online learning platforms like Udemy and Skillshare, and specialized training providers.

5. What are the best Canva features to learn?

Start with basic tools like templates, text editing, and image uploading. Then, explore advanced features like animations, video editing, and collaboration tools.
